Monday - "Strange Condition" - Morgan Page - If you think this song sounds familiar, you are correct. This is a cover of the original Pete Yorn version. Page is a DJ from LA who is releasing his new album "Believe" later this month.



Tuesday - "Boys & Girls" -Martin Solveig feat. Dragonette - So I have dabbled in a lot of Euro pop for you guys and this one sticks in that genre but is actually French. An electronic DJ in France, Solveig hosts a radio show and released this fun track last year.




Wednesday - "My Turn" - Basement Jaxx feat. Lightspeed Champion - So remember last week when I told you I used to obsess about their album "Rooty"? Well it's starting again, this is a great track of their album "Scars." So many more to come!



Thursday - "Black & Gold" - Sam Sparro - This song was actually featured in two terrible movies last year "Obsessed" with Beyonce and "Fame". I didn't see the latter but heard it wasn't very good and I suffered through half of the 'Beyonce and the chick from Heroes version' of "Fatal Attraction" on DVD.



Friday - "Boys & Girls" - Pixie Lott - I featured this UK import a few playlists ago. This is another one of my favorites! Make your state-side debut already Pixie!



Saturday - "Animal" - Miike Snow - No, that is not a misspelling, they have two 'i's" in their name if you have having trouble finding the song. Formed in 2007, this is a Swedish band that includes the two producers Bloodshy & Avant who are responsible for 'Toxic" by Britney Spears.



Sunday - "Paradise Circus" - Massive Attack feat. Hope Sandoval - Do you miss Mazzy Star? I sure do! Hope Sandoval a.k.a Mazzy Star makes an appearance on the new Massive Attack album called Hegioland due this month. Definitely a trippy slow jam for a lazy Sunday!
